What is a Screened-In Porch?
A screened-in Porch Installation Services is a covered outdoor area that is surrounded by screens rather than strong walls. These spaces are ideal for taking pleasure in fresh air while being protected from insects, debris, and weather condition elements. Different styles can match various architectural designs, varying from rustic to modernized appearances.

While the advantages are plenty, planning your screened-in porch installation takes mindful consideration. Below are essential aspects to consider when teaming up with screened-in Porch Installer Near Me installers.
1. Size and Layout
Identify just how much area is offered and how you wish to utilize the location. Consider your outdoor furnishings and the number of individuals you expect accommodating.
2. Design Style
Screened-in decks can be designed in different designs, including conventional, contemporary, or even rustic. Make certain the style matches your home's existing architecture.
3. Materials
Pick the best materials for floor covering, roofing, and the screens themselves. Typical options consist of wood, aluminum, and vinyl.
4. Heating and cooling Options
If you prepare to utilize your porch year-round, consider how you might heat up or cool the area. Alternatives consist of ceiling fans, portable heaters, and even integrated systems.
5. Budget
Develop Build A Porch budget before consulting with installers. This will help you make notified decisions about materials and design.

What to Expect During Installation
Comprehending the installation procedure can alleviate your issues and guide you on what to expect when dealing with screened-in porch installers.
Initial Consultation
The procedure typically starts with an assessment. Here, you'll discuss your ideas and requirements. Measurements might be taken, and general design strategies will be designed.
Preparation and Design Approval
When the style is prepared, the installers will call you for approval. Any modifications or modifications can be made throughout this phase.
Website Preparation
Installers will prepare the site, which includes clearing particles and making sure the ground is level for construction.
Construction Phase
This is when the actual work starts. Installers will normally follow these steps:
Foundation Construction: If your porch will have a foundation, it will require to be established initially.Vertical Support Frame: The frame for the roofing and walls will be constructed next.Screen Installation: Screens will be set up to keep pests out.Finishing Touches: Addition of details like paint, floor covering, electrical work, and furniture assembly.Last Walkthrough
When the installation is complete, a last walkthrough will be performed to make sure that everything fulfills your expectations and is operating effectively.
Regularly Asked Questions1. Just how much does a screened-in porch cost?
The expense can differ considerably depending on size, materials, and design but usually ranges from ₤ 5,000 to ₤ 25,000.
2. Can I utilize my screened-in porch year-round?
Yes, you can utilize your porch year-round if it is appropriately fitted with heating or cooling systems.
3. How do I preserve my screened-in porch?
Regular cleansing of the screens, sweeping the floorings, and routine assessments for wear will keep your porch looking its best.
4. Are there any zoning guidelines?
Talk to your local zoning workplace to determine if you need a license or if there are any restrictions on constructing a screened-in porch.
5. Can I DIY my screened-in porch?
While it's possible, it's recommended to seek advice from experts due to the design complexity and allowing procedures included.
